The Semenggoh Orangutan Centre, established in 1964, acts as an important haven for the rehabilitation and preservation of orangutans in Malaysia. Situated about 24 kilometers from Kuching, the center extends over 740 hectares of all-natural rain forest, offering a favorable atmosphere for the orangutans to flourish. It mainly concentrates on rehabilitating saved orangutans, a number of whom have been displaced because of logging and prohibited pet dog profession.The facility runs under the auspices of the Sarawak Forestry Corporation and is devoted to educating the general public regarding the significance of orangutan preservation. Visitors to Semenggoh can observe these amazing creatures in their all-natural environment throughout feeding times, while guides give understandings into the orangutans' actions and conservation efforts. The center also plays a crucial role in study and tracking of wild orangutan populations, adding to ongoing conservation campaigns.
Furthermore, the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re highlights sustainable practices, functioning closely with neighborhood neighborhoods to promote understanding and involvement in preservation initiatives. This diverse approach makes certain the long-lasting survival of orangutans and their environment, making the center a foundation of wild animals conservation in Malaysia.
Relevance of Orangutan Conservation
Orangutan conservation plays a vital role not just in protecting a varieties that is seriously jeopardized however additionally in preserving the ecological balance of tropical rain forests. As keystone species, orangutans add significantly to woodland health and wellness by promoting seed dispersal. Their feeding practices advertise plant variety and support the general structure of the environment.The decrease of orangutan populations, largely as a result of habitat loss from logging, illegal logging, and palm oil farming, poses a considerable risk not just to their survival yet also to the intricate internet of life within their habitats (Semenggoh Wildlife Centre). Shielding orangutans ensures the preservation of the varied vegetation and animals that share their atmosphere, therefore promoting biodiversity
By cultivating lasting techniques and sustaining regional areas, orangutan conservation efforts can lead to more sustainable land use and financial growth. Ultimately, the conservation of orangutans is vital for guarding the ecological stability of exotic rain forests and making certain a sustainable future for both wildlife and mankind.

Finest Times to See Orangutans

In regards to seasonal factors to consider, the dry season, which typically covers from March to October, is optimal for finding orangutans. Throughout this duration, the weather is typically extra desirable, with less rainfall, enabling much better presence and ease of access within the reserve. On the other hand, the wet season, from November to February, can cause sloppy tracks and raised vegetation, making it extra tough to find the orangutans.
Eventually, seeing throughout the morning or late mid-day can yield the finest results, as orangutans are extra energetic throughout these cooler components of the day. By aligning your visit with these optimal times, you enhance your chances of experiencing the amazing world of orangutans at Semenggoh.
